Dryer Vent Cleaning

According to the U.S Fire Administration, “2,900 home clothes dryer fires are reported each year and cause an estimated 5 deaths, 100 injuries, and $35 million in property loss.” Unfortunately, no dryer is immune to fire… unless you receive a professional dryer vent cleaning! Without proper dryer vent cleaning, your system can fill up with lint, fill up your vents, and spark a fire. - What is involved in a dryer vent cleaning?

Our dryer vent cleaning involves an initial inspection of the dryer, thorough cleaning of lint traps, ductwork, and all components of your dryer using advanced equipment, a measurement of airflow, and a final diagnosis, repair, and total safety check.

- What are the different types of indoor air quality systems?

There are many subcategories of air purification systems. The main types are UV air purifiers, ionization, and extended media filters.
